复习题上
第七章单元测试
1.下列情况可能导致死锁的是(多个进程竟争资源出现了循环等待 )。
2.在操作系统中,死锁出现是指( 若干进程因竟争资源而无限等待其他进程释放已占有的资源 )。
3.一次分配所有资源的方法可以预防死锁的发生,它破坏的死四个必要条件中的( 请求并保持)。
4. 死锁的避免是根据( 防止系统进入不安全状态)采取措施实现的。
5.以下有关资源分配图的描述中正确的是( 资源分配图是一个有向图,用于表示某时刻系统资源与进程之间的状态 )。
6.死锁与安全状态的关系是( 死锁状态一定是不安全状态 )。
7.在下列死锁的解决方法中,属于死锁避免策略的是( 银行家算法 )。
8.解除死锁通常不采用的方法是( 从非死锁进程处抢夺资源 )。
9.死锁的四个必要条件中,无法破坏的是( 互斥 )。
10.某系统中有三个并发进程都需要四个同类资源,该系统不会发生死锁的最少资源是( 10)。
11.死锁避免是通过打破死锁的必要条件实现的。×
12.采用资源剥夺可以解除死锁,还可以采用终止进程的方法解除死锁。√
13.在银行家算法中,对某时刻的资源分配情况进行安全分析,如果该时刻状态是安全的,则会找到不止一个安全序列 ×
14.在一个有N个进程的单处理机系统中,有可能出现N个进程都被阻塞的情况。√
15.为了避免死锁的发生,各进程应该按序逐个申请资源。×
第八章单元测试
1.存储管理的目的是(方便用户和提高内存利用率)。
2.把作业空间中使用的逻辑地址变为内存中物理地址称为(重定位 )。
3.内存保护需要由(操作系统和硬件机构合作